Conquer Hot Flashes and Night Sweats Naturally
Are you struggling with the intense symptoms of menopause like hot flashes and night sweats? These waves can disrupt your sleep, affect your daily life, and leave you feeling drained. But don't stress! There are many natural ways to find comfort and regain control over your well-being.
By adopting some simple lifestyle adjustments, you can alleviate the severity of these symptoms. Here are a few recommendations:
- Stay cool by dressing in layers, using fans, and staying clear of spicy foods and caffeine.
- Engage in stress-reducing techniques like yoga, meditation, or deep breathing exercises.
- Consume a healthy di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ains.
- Look into herbal remedies like black cohosh or primrose oil.
Remember to talk to your doctor to determine the optimal course of treatment for you. With a little effort and commitment, you can successfully manage hot flashes and night sweats naturally.

Overcome the Heat: Herbal Remedies for Menopause Symptoms
Menopause can be a difficult time for women, bringing a host of uncomfortable symptoms. One of the most common troubles is feeling overheated, which can leave you feeling flushed and drained. Fortunately, there are many effective natural remedies to help you manage these symptoms and feel your best.
A few simple changes to your daily routine can make a big impact.
Keep h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day. This helps regulate body temperature and prevent the severity of hot flashes.
Select loose-fitting, breathable clothing made from natural fibers like cotton or linen. Avoid tight clothing that can trap heat.
Practice stress management techniques such as yoga, meditation, or deep breathing exercises. Stress can exacerbate menopause symptoms, so finding ways to relax and unwind is essential.
